
战斗力是一个综合了玩家各种表现的一个综合数值,是一个化繁为简的数值。 战斗力由三部分组成,(1)基础分 (2)胜率加成分 (3)胜场加成分。 简而言之,如果一个人的胜场越多、胜率越高、排位赛的积分越高,战斗力就会越高。四、战斗力的详细算法 1、基础分 所有参与排位赛的玩家,都会有一个基础段位,详细见官方说明。我们根据玩家排位的段位,计算出一个基础分。 (1)第一步,根据段位得到一个段位换算分。 玩家的胜点分将除以2.5加到段位换算分上。 如果一个玩家没打过排位,他的段位换算分设为1150。 (2)基础分 = 段位换算分*1.2* (1+(段位换算分-1000)/2000)^1.6 简述之,如果玩家的段位和胜点越高,这个基础分也越高,呈指数级增长。 除此之外,段位换算分还会在其它两个战斗力组成的计算中有加成作用,因此最有效提高战斗力的方法就是去打排位赛。 另外,如果一个玩家只打电脑,则他的基础分是1.2*(600+等级*10) 2、胜场加成分 战斗胜利场数越多的人,加分越多。 这场分值会稳定增长,主要反映一个玩家是不是够老江湖,上限3500分。 计算公式为:2*匹配赛胜场^0.9 + 3*全赛季各种排位赛总胜场^0.9 只打电脑的玩家胜场加成分为胜场数*1.5 3、胜率加成分 胜率即 胜场/总场次,下面用winRatio表示。 详细规则如下: (1)先计算出匹配赛和所有赛季排位赛的总胜率winRatio。 (2)如果胜率超过70%,会最高只算70%;匹配赛打超过100场的胜率超过70%的极其罕见。 (3)如果胜率大于50%,胜率加成分计算公式:750+100*(winRatio-50)^0.7;如果胜率低于50%,胜率加成分公式:750 -(100*(50-$winRatio)^0.7)。胜率加成分下面用winRatioScore代替. (4)在上面第三步的基础上,进行胜场调节: - 如果胜场低于40场,则胜率加成分为winRatioScore*胜场/40; - 再根据胜场的总场次,对winRatioScore进行进一步加成 (5)在上面第四步的基础上,进行rank加成计算,超过1500 rank分的玩家胜率分有逐步加成(到2500分约加成1.6)。 (6)最后再乘以1.2。 (7)只打电脑的玩家不计算胜率分。 此项分值最高可达到约5000分左右;如果一个人的胜率低于35%,则可能只拿到0分
